Title: Innovations of Richard T. Wilkins
Introduction
Richard T. Wilkins is a notable inventor based in College Station, TX (US). He has made significant contributions to the field of nanotechnology and radiation monitoring. With a total of 4 patents, his work has advanced the understanding and application of nanostructures in various scientific domains.
Latest Patents
Wilkins' latest patents include groundbreaking technologies such as "Real time radiation monitoring using nanotechnology." This system and method focus on monitoring the receipt and estimating the flux value of incident radiation in real time. It utilizes two or more nanostructures (NSs) and associated terminals to provide closed electrical paths. The invention measures one or more electrical property change values (ΔEPV) associated with irradiated NSs during a sequence of irradiation time intervals. The effects of irradiation, both with and without healing, are modeled separately for first and second order healing. Wilkins' work allows for the estimation of flux and cumulative dose received by NSs based on ΔEPV change values. Additionally, he has developed a patent on "Functionalized carbon nanotube-polymer composites and interactions with radiation." This invention explores the interaction of radiation with functionalized carbon nanotubes incorporated into various host materials, particularly polymers.
Career Highlights
Throughout his career, Richard T. Wilkins has worked with prestigious institutions such as William Marsh Rice University and NASA. His research has focused on the innovative applications of nanotechnology in radiation monitoring and material science.
Collaborations
Wilkins has collaborated with esteemed colleagues, including Enrique V. Barrera and Meisha Shofner. Their combined expertise has contributed to the advancement of research in nanotechnology and its applications.
